Hearts of Iron IV | Supremacy: Call of War 1942 | |
|---|---|---|
| Released | 2016 | 2017 |
| Genres | Strategy, Simulation | Strategy, Simulation, Massively Multiplayer, Free To Play |
| Platforms | Windows, macOS, Linux | Windows, macOS |
| Steam Deck | Deck Playable | Deck Playable |
| Price | 14.99 USD | Free to play |
| Steam reviews | 91.1% positive (120,833 reviews) | 64.4% positive (2,211 reviews) |
| Multiplayer | Multi-player, Cross-Platform Multiplayer, Co-op | Multi-player, Cross-Platform Multiplayer, Online Co-op |
| Developers | Paradox Development Studio | Bytro Labs GmbH |
